Overview Travel Resource Coordinators are responsible for managing the travel resources of a company or organization. They are responsible for researching and booking travel arrangements, coordinating travel logistics, and providing customer service to travelers. They also manage the budget for travel expenses and ensure that all travel policies and procedures are followed. Detailed Job Description Travel Resource Coordinators are responsible for researching and booking travel arrangements for employees and clients. This includes researching and booking flights, hotels, car rentals, and other travel-related services. They must also coordinate travel logistics, such as arranging ground transportation, obtaining visas and passports, and providing customer service to travelers.
